Default How to : Test account that can not send mails

I want to make a class of service that allow to view zimbra webmail and another features, but that they cant send emails, to avoid spam.

Is this possible ?

If you wanted, would be to have a default username for these users (ie if you are demoing) so lets say you have a demo1@domain.com you can restrict just that user from sending out any mail rather than making a new class of service.

Is that something you would be after. Found this in the wiki.
Restrict users to certain domain - Zimbra :: Wiki
